About the job

About the role

Samsara (NYSE: IOT) is the pioneer of the Connected Operations™ Cloud, enabling organizations that depend on physical operations to harness IoT data. We are looking for an experienced Compliance Product Support Engineer to join our Global Technical Support organization. This role serves as the primary technical authority for the ELD compliance product, bridging customers, field teams, and R&D to ensure 100% accuracy in recording Hours of Service (HOS) and Records of Duty Status (RODS).

Responsibilities

  • Serve as the final escalation point for intricate ELD compliance product issues.
  • Own the end-to-end lifecycle of complex product issues, coordinating with R&D.
  • Analyze device telemetry and fleet-level patterns using internal tools.
  • Provide technical support for audits & inspections.
  • Drive continuous product improvement through post-mortem analyses.
  • Collaborate with Support and R&D teams to resolve escalations.
  • Lead technical feedback for new products.
  • Define success criteria, validation plans, and operational runbooks.
  • Develop or contribute to internal tools.
  • Elevate technical expertise through coaching and case reviews.

Minimum requirements

  • B.S. in Computer Science, Engineering, or other technical field.
  • 6+ years of experience in technical support, field engineering, or systems engineering with distributed, hardware-integrated products.
  • Familiarity with ELD rules and regulations.
  • Excellent customer service and communication skills.
  • Technical know-how with SaaS systems.
  • Experience in direct customer interaction, incident response, and on-call support.

Ideal candidate

  • Experience with fleet regulatory requirements.
  • Telematics industry experience a plus.
  • Data analysis skills; Python, SQL, and Tableau.
